Output 018ef59812e888861c2c0f4b792bf8be430c9a5920e7ea6cb2cb7cefa7fe8caa:0

value
37842264
script pubkey
OP_0 OP_PUSHBYTES_20 ca73c17ed4a8f85a3a7128564efa839e796e29fe
address
bc1qefeuzlk54ru95wn39ptya75rneuku207m8lewj
transaction
018ef59812e888861c2c0f4b792bf8be430c9a5920e7ea6cb2cb7cefa7fe8caa
spent
true